Tennis Announces 2026 Spring Schedule
January 02, 2026 | Tennis
The Minutewomen will host 11 home dual matches.
AMHERST, Mass. – University of Massachusetts women's tennis announced a competitive slate for the Spring 2026 season on Friday afternoon. The regular season features 11 dual matches that will be played either indoors at the Bay Road Tennis Club or outdoors at the Mullins Tennis Courts, while opening the year with a matchup on the road against Bryant.
With its first season in the Mid-American Conference, Massachusetts will play eight league matches. UMass will host Bowling Green, Eastern Michigan, Northern Illinois and Buffalo, while traveling to Miami (OH), Ball State, Western Michigan and Toledo throughout the season.
The Minutewomen return five members of the 2024-25 team, including graduate student Renata Farima, senior Ella Faessler, junior Amelia Tye and sophomores Owethu Makhanya and Martina Pavissich. Four newcomers joined the UMass squad this season, adding junior transfer Amanda de Oliveira and welcoming freshmen Fiona Ao, Duru Baycan and Madara Markevica.
Massachusetts finished the 2024-25 year with a 12-7 overall record, including a 4-0 record in the Atlantic 10 Conference, while completing its home schedule with a 7-2 record.
UMass reached the A-10 semifinals for the ninth time in program history and fourth time with Juancarlos Nunez at the helm.
During the A-10 Tournament, the No. 2-seeded Minutewomen received a bye into the quarterfinals, downing No. 7 Rhode Island, 4-1, to advance to the semifinals. The team fell to No. 3 Richmond, 4-0, in the round, to close out the season.
